Knight of Pentacles Meaning

The Rider Waite 'Knight of Pentacles' embodies a dependable and hardworking individual who is practical, responsible, and cautious. He values routine and persistence and is committed to achieving his goals steadily and securely, often associated with a focus on material or financial matters.

Keywords:

dependable, hardworking, practical, cautious, persistent, responsible, routine, steady growth

Knight of Pentacles Reversed Meaning

When reversed, the card signals a tendency to be stubborn, overly cautious, or resistant to change, resulting in delays or missed opportunities. It also warns against laziness and lack of progress due to complacency.

Reversed Keywords:

stubborn, cautious, resistant to change, lazy, complacent, delays, missed opportunities

Knight of Pentacles by Life Area

Knight of Pentacles in Love

Upright

When upright, the Knight of Pentacles indicates a stable and reliable relationship where both partners are committed to nurturing their bond. This card may suggest that you or your partner are focused on building a future together, whether that means discussing long-term goals or solidifying a commitment.

Reversed

In reverse, the Knight of Pentacles points to potential issues such as stubbornness or inflexibility within the relationship. You may find yourself or your partner resistant to change or unwilling to adapt, leading to frustration and stagnation in the relationship.

Knight of Pentacles in Career

Upright

In a career context, this card signifies diligence and a strong work ethic, indicating that your efforts are likely to pay off. You may be in line for a promotion or successfully managing a long-term project that requires patience and attention to detail.

Reversed

Reversed, the Knight of Pentacles highlights career challenges such as a lack of motivation or being stuck in a monotonous routine. You could be facing delays in your projects, or your resistance to change may limit your career advancement opportunities.

Knight of Pentacles in Health

Upright

When upright, the Knight of Pentacles suggests a focus on maintaining a healthy routine. This could involve sticking to a balanced diet, regular exercise, or taking practical steps to improve your overall well-being.

Reversed

In reverse, this card warns against neglecting your health due to complacency or a stagnating routine. It may indicate a need to reassess lifestyle choices that are negatively affecting your physical or mental health.

Knight of Pentacles in Finances

Upright

The Knight of Pentacles in an upright position suggests that your financial situation is stable and that you are making careful, long-term investments. It's a good time to focus on building savings and spending wisely rather than indulging in impulsive purchases.

Reversed

When reversed, this card warns of financial pitfalls such as overspending or failing to recognize opportunities for growth. You may be experiencing a tendency to procrastinate on financial planning or becoming too complacent about your spending habits.

Knight of Pentacles as Feelings

As feelings, the Knight of Pentacles reflects a sense of responsibility and commitment. The person may feel a deep sense of loyalty and a desire to build a stable future with you, though they may also appear somewhat serious or overly cautious in expressing their emotions.

Knight of Pentacles as Intentions

In terms of intentions, this card indicates a desire for stability and a long-term commitment. The individual likely wants to take practical steps toward solidifying the relationship, even if they seem slow or methodical in their approach.

Knight of Pentacles Symbolism & Imagery

The Knight of Pentacles is depicted riding a sturdy horse, which symbolizes reliability and a grounded nature. He is dressed in armor adorned with pentacle symbols, representing his focus on material concerns and practicality. The lush green fields in the background signify growth and fertility, while the overall calmness of the scene reflects a steady, methodical approach to life.
